Ambassador
Mr. Jorge Carvajal San Martín
- Permanent Representative to the Organization for the Prohibition of Chemical Weapons, OPCW.
- Geographer from the Pontifical Catholic University of Chile, graduate of the Andrés Bello Diplomatic Academy. Has courses at the Academy of International Law in The Hague, at the International Atomic Energy Agency in Vienna, and Political Science at the University of Stockholm.
- During his career he has served as Director of the Middle East and Africa Division, Head of the Argentine Unit in the South America Division, in addition to having served in the International Security Division, among others.
- Abroad, he has served in the Chilean Mission to International Organizations based in Vienna, the Chilean embassies to the Kingdom of the Netherlands; the United Kingdom; the Kingdom of Sweden; Romania; and Israel, where he served as ambassador until his appointment as Ambassador to the Kingdom of the Netherlands.
